    KL Uber Alles

    Kuala Lumpur Is Top Global City for Expats

    Malaysian capital ranks high because of its cheaper housing costs and low taxes, according to new research.



    The skyline of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. Photographer: Samsul Said
    Bloomberg ByAlice Kantor

    November 26, 2022 at 1:00 AM GMT+7

    Kuala Lumpur is the best city for expats, according to research by US-based language learning app Preply.
    People moving to the Malaysian capital can get by on the equivalent of about $1,091 a month, benefitting from low taxes and housing costs. Tbilisi in Georgia, Lisbon, Dubai and Bangkok are also at the top of the list, which focused on factors including affordability, internet connectivity, safety and how hard the local language is to learn.

    After the pandemic shuttered offices around the world, more people took advantage of remote worker visas, which surged in popularity and are now offered by more than 30 countries.

    Tbilisi ranks second as the best city for expats, according to Preply’s index. The Georgian city is safe, has a relatively low cost of living and offers many attractions. Lisbon, meanwhile, is attractive for its affordable lifestyle, with the Portuguese capital costing about $1,651 a month for expats.

    Countries ranked 6-10:

    6. Prague: $2254
    7. Madrid: $2021
    8. Barcelona: $2090
    9. Alicante: $1320
    10. Montreal: $2074
